日期:2014-05-20  浏览次数:20721 次

怎样得到JAVA可运行程序
如题:
  怎样得到一个JAVA可运行的程序。就是说,我现在把JAVA程序写好,也已经可以编译运行了。得到了   .class后,怎样才能把这一堆文件弄成可以   双击就执行的程序?
盼回答~~

------解决方案--------------------
jar打包发行
安全,快速下载,压缩,猎取包,版本化包,可携。
各种java编程工具都提供jar打包功能,也可以用命令行
先打开命令提示符输入jar –help,然后回车,看到什么:
==================================
用法:jar {ctxu}[vfm0Mi] [jar-文件] [manifest-文件] [-C 目录] 文件名 ...
选项:
-c 创建新的存档
-t 列出存档内容的列表
-x 展开存档中的命名的(或所有的〕文件
-u 更新已存在的存档
-v 生成详细输出到标准输出上
-f 指定存档文件名
-m 包含来自标明文件的标明信息
-0 只存储方式;未用ZIP压缩格式
-M 不产生所有项的清单(manifest〕文件
-i 为指定的jar文件产生索引信息
-C 改变到指定的目录,并且包含下列文件:


------解决方案--------------------
在d:\java\classes
下新建一个bat文件如 run.bat
然后在文件中写入下代码
@echo off
start java myFrame
保存
双击run.bat
------解决方案--------------------
////////////////////////////////
创建一个MyManifest.mf文件,内容:
Main-Class: Helloworld

///////////////////////////////
在命令窗口输入:
Helloworld.class文件所在路径:\> jar cvfm MyClasses.jar MyManifest.mf Helloworld.class

///////////////////////////
双击classes.jar就可以运行Helloworld.class了